Harold R. Pomeroy

April 24, 1943 — August 5, 2025

Hammond, NY

Harold R. Pomeroy, age 82, passed away peacefully surrounded by family.

Born to the late Ransford and Virginia Pomeroy, Harold was a proud and devoted man who lived a life marked by service, dedication, and deep love for his family.

He is survived by his wife of 58 years, Linda Lee Pomeroy, and his sister, Linda Nell Pomeroy. Harold was a devoted father to Jeffrey Pomeroy (Tammy) and Teresa Johnson (Mitchel), a proud grandfather to Jacqueline Pomeroy, Joseph Pomeroy (Keara), and Jacob Pomeroy (Sierra), and a loving great-grandfather to Hadley Rose Pomeroy and Harlow Sage Pomeroy.

Harold honorably served in the United States Navy from 1962 to 1966, a period of his life of which he was immensely proud. His commitment to service continued through his active membership in both American Legion Post 32 (Walton, NY) and American Legion Post 69 (Avon Park, FL), as well as the Moose Club, where he found lasting friendships and camaraderie.

After his military service, Harold worked for the U.S. Postal Service as a rural postal carrier, faithfully serving for 30 years. Known for going above and beyond, he took special care of the people on his route—especially the elderly—ensuring they were not only delivered mail but also treated with kindness, respect, and watchful care.

An avid hunter and fisherman, Harold loved spending time outdoors, but above all else, he cherished time with his family. His humor, warmth, and steadfast presence will be deeply missed by all who knew him.

A life of quiet strength, humble service, and unconditional love—Harold's legacy lives on in the generations he nurtured and the lives he touched.
